Hey — handing over Pingora, our deploy-status chat bot. It mostly runs itself; the only flaky part is the webhook retry logic, which I've left notes on in the repo. Restarts are safe anytime. If it goes quiet, check the poller first. The config it's currently running with is pasted below.

deployment values, yadug-bawif:
[framir]
team = pelox
access_code = ac_a38ab2
owner = tamion.julael
host = framir.tolvaqlabs.test
port = 11211
peer = tammir.zemvargrid.local
salt = 2215ef03
pin = 1541

Handover: Exportron retry queue

Hi Mira — handing over the failed-export retries. Exports that hit a timeout land in the retry queue and get three attempts with backoff; after that they're parked and need a manual requeue from the admin panel. Watch for customers reporting duplicates — that usually means a double requeue. The current retry settings are as follows.

settings of bajog-fawig:
oliael:
  log_level: warn
  metrics_host: metrics.oliael.zemvarsys.internal
  pin: 0267
  pool_size: 32

## Changelog — Willowmark 3.8.2

Template rendering performance improved substantially this cycle. We replaced the per-request template compile with a warmed LRU cache keyed on template hash, cutting median render time from 210ms to 38ms on the Bramhollow benchmark suite. Partial includes are now precompiled at deploy time, and a regression guard was added to CI to fail builds on >10% render slowdown. Direct all questions about these changes to:

named custodian: Belius Casath Ulaix Sorius

// Heads up, reviewer: this client wires up the Nightfill scheduler that
// kicks off our nightly data backfills for the Lumenark warehouse. It
// runs at 02:15 local so it lands after the Driftwell ETL finishes, and
// retries twice with jittered backoff before paging anyone. Don't bump
// the batch size past 500 — we tried that in staging and the merge step
// fell over. Auth against the internal Nightfill gateway uses the key
// directly below this comment.

API key for kahop-bagef: zpat2_yb